About The Position

STV is seeking a motivated and detail-oriented Field Engineer – Aviation to join our national Aviation group. This position will be fully onsite at one of our aviation client sites located in Los Angeles, CA, San Francisco, CA, Phoenix, AZ, or Denver, CO. This position will support the planning, construction, and delivery of complex aviation infrastructure projects. This role is ideal for candidates who thrive in dynamic airport environments and enjoy collaborating with multidisciplinary teams across design, construction, and operations. The Field Engineer will work closely with project managers, contractors, airport stakeholders, and design teams to support airside and landside construction activities while ensuring quality, safety, schedule, and regulatory compliance.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Civil Engineering, Construction Management, Aviation Management, or related field.
  • 2–6 years of experience in construction, aviation infrastructure, transportation, or related engineering projects.
  • Understanding of construction methods, engineering plans, and field coordination processes.
  • Strong communication, organizational, and probl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to work in active construction and airport operational environments.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ite and construction management software platforms.
  • Valid driver’s license and ability to travel to project sites as needed.

Nice To Haves

  • Experience supporting aviation, airport, or transportation infrastructure projects.
  • Familiarity with FAA advisory circulars, airport operations, and aviation design/construction standards.
  • EIT certification or progress toward PE licensure preferred.
  • Experience with Primavera P6, Procore, Bluebeam, AutoCAD, or similar platforms.
  • OSHA 10 or OSHA 30 certification preferred.

Responsibilities

  • Support field execution of aviation and airport infrastructure projects including terminals, airfields, utilities, roadways, and support facilities.
  • Coordinate with contractors, inspectors, airport operations personnel, and project teams to facilitate construction activities.
  • Monitor construction progress, quality, and adherence to project plans and specifications.
  • Assist with RFIs, submittments, change orders, punch lists, and field documentation.
  • Conduct site inspections and document daily construction activities and field observations.
  • Review drawings, schedules, and technical specifications for constructability and compliance.
  • Support project controls including tracking budgets, schedules, quantities, and project milestones.
  • Ensure compliance with FAA requirements, airport standards, environmental regulations, and safety protocols.
  • Participate in meetings with clients, contractors, and regulatory agencies.
  • Assist with coordination of utility relocations, phasing plans, and operational constraints within active airport environments.
  • Promote a strong culture of safety and quality throughout all project phases.
